Veeam Innovation Awards for 2019

Building on the success of the inaugural Veeam Innovation Awards (VIAs) at VeeamON 2018, where we recognized partners who were developing solutions that were powered by Veeam, we are announcing open submissions for Veeam Innovation Awards 2019.

The top three solutions will be awarded VIAs at Veeam’s Velocity event in January 2019 in Orlando, Florida. These three VIA winners will be notified of their selection on November 15th and Veeam will help the three VIA winners in developing videos and ensuring their ability to join us at Velocity 2019. The videos will be used by the broader Veeam community to vote on “Best of Show” to be celebrated during our Velocity event.

Life after vSphere 5.5 End of General Support

The end of general support for vSphere 5.5 was on September 19, 2018. There may be a number of questions for those customers that are still sitting on vSphere 5.5, like what version do I upgrade to? And what considerations do I need to make as part of the support upgrade path? Read more

Does California’s own GDPR create more problems than it answers?

The recent introduction of the General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) has done a lot to tackle issues surrounding business’ exploitation of personal data and has led to calls by some tech leaders for a similar legislative approach in the U.S. at a Federal Government level. Just last month, “The California Consumer Privacy Act of 2018” was created, promising similar rights for the State’s 40 million citizens as Europeans received with GDPR.

Veeam Data Incident: Update from Peter McKay

Data privacy is something that Veeam takes very seriously. Unfortunately, this week, we had an incident where one of our marketing databases was mistakenly left visible to unauthorized third parties. One of our Veeam core values is transparency and I want to be very open and honest about this issue – this is what our employees, customers and partners deserve. Our goal is to share so our community can learn from our situation.

During some maintenance of our network, this single marketing database containing marketing records (that may include names, e-mail addresses and IP addresses) was left visible and exposed due to human error.
